DetailBiz makes public debut at SEMA 2011
Friday, December 30, 2011 at 12:19PM DetailBiz, worlds first automotive detail business management software, makes public debut at SEMA 2011
Las Vegas, NV 2011: DetailBiz is the first to market management software made specifically for the automotive detail business. After over two years in research and development, DetailBiz made its public debut at the SEMA show in Las Vegas on November 1st 2011. With endorsement by the Smartwax – Chemical Guys team, a global leader in professional detailing products and training, DetailBiz is positioned to make a big splash in the professional detailing community.

DetailBiz is a cloud web application deployed in the Google App Engine. In basic terms, the software is available anytime on any device that has web access from a desktop to a smartphone. “The mobile detailing segment is growing very quickly” says David Knotek, DetailBiz Executive Director, “we needed to deliver this product on a platform that complimented the mobile business model.” DetailBiz behaves much like a native iPhone or Android app but does so in a browser. It is optimized for touchscreen technologies and positioned as a perfect partner with any tablet device but even on a desktop or laptop, the experience remains the same.
DetailBiz utilizes a subscription model that is common among software applications of this nature. Every new user will receive a 30 day free trial period to decide whether or not the system is right for them. During this trial period the user will receive one on one help from the DetailBiz team to get them familiar with the systems functionality. After the trial period the user can subscribe monthly at $49. Considering the average price per detail service is well north of $100, this system is a relative value if it can deliver on its promise of “total control of your business in the palm of your hand” as stated on the websites homepage (www.detailbiz.com).
